Protection from child trafficking is not only a political commitment, but also the responsibility of each of us. Deputy Minister of ESH


The 25th Conference of the OSCE Trafficking Against Trafficking of the OSCE and the Deputy Minister of Labor and Social Affairs, Head of Trafficking and Women's Issues, was also involved in Vienna. This was reported by the ASS Ministry.

"Protection of childhood, the formation of the future. High-ranking officials of various countries, representatives of international and civil society organizations were present at the conference entitled to discuss the work on the protection of children's rights and the fight against child trafficking, and the options for the fight against child trafficking were attended at the conference entitled.

During the conference, Tatevik Stepanyan also made a speech, emphasizing the importance of the work carried out by the Republic of Armenia in the direction of the protection of children's rights and the fight against trafficking. In this context, the Deputy Minister presented the sectoral policy, to detail the measures taken by various cooperation and the legislative changes in the field of child protection.

Touching upon the community-based child and family support services in Armenia, Tatevik Stepanyan spoke about the development of alternative care, and the support programs for children who have suffered trafficking, and regularly on specialized training courses, as well as a word-valuus model.

Given the possible vulnerability of children displaced by conflicts, the speaker also emphasized the role of the Republic of Armenia to integrate anti-trafficking measures in the social protection system.

"Protection from child trafficking is not only a political commitment, but also the responsibility of each of us. Armenia is ready to cooperate with all stakeholders to ensure a safer and fair future of our children, "he said.

Within the framework of the conference, Tateik Stepanyan met with the representatives of Sweden, Germany and the OSCE, discussed issues related to the expansion of bilateral cooperation in the fight against child protection and trafficking.

During the meeting with the OSCE Special Representative for Trafficking Kary Johnston, the Deputy Minister presented the sectoral reforms and emphasized the importance of continuous cooperation with international partners. Karary Johnston welcomed the work aimed at implementing joint initiatives in the fight against trafficking. The latter also expressed readiness to take active steps in that direction in the near future.
